Leveraging in Sector ETFs for Targeted Growth and Diversification
Sector Exchange Traded Funds (ETFs) present a compelling avenue in investors targeting both targeted growth coupled with diversification within their portfolios. By concentrating on specific industries, such as technology, healthcare, or energy, investors have the ability to amplify their exposure within sectors exhibiting strong performance. Additionally, ETFs offer a budget-friendly way through achieve diversification, as they typically comprise a basket of securities within a particular sector. This methodology helps to mitigate risk by spreading investments across multiple companies, thus creating a more resilient portfolio.
Finally, investing in sector ETFs offers a valuable tool for investors looking to tailor their portfolios aligned with their specific financial goals. However, it's crucial to conduct thorough research and understand the risks and rewards associated with each sector before implementing any investment decisions.
